"Right to be Forgotten" and the Modern DPO

The most common regulatory trigger in 2026 is the failure to honor Data Subject Access Requests (DSAR). If you cannot quickly export or delete a user’s data, you are in breach. Yes, if you use non-essential cookies (analytics, ads, tracking), you must have a "Freely Given" and "Informed" consent mechanism under GDPR Art. 7.

Fines can reach up to 4% of global annual turnover or €20 million, whichever is higher. 2026 enforcement trends show a rise in fines for poor AI transparency.

A DPO is a mandatory role for organizations that process large-scale sensitive data. They are responsible for monitoring compliance and acting as a point of contact for regulators.
